Aunt assaults 14 year old niece with hot pressing iron in Lagos

Fourteen year old Mariam Iman has being reportedly burnt with pressing iron by her cousin in bariga Lagos state.

According to a source who pleaded anonymous, the victim whose father is dead and abandoned by my mother lives with her cousin Zainab also known as mummy Phillips at  22/24 Oyenaiya street iIaje Bariga.

Ogunwatch learnt that the victim was questioned about her cousin’s movement by the husband and after disclosing,  it led to an argument between the husband and wife which made Zainab beat her and then burnt her two breast with a pressing iron.

“ The husband visits Lagos occasionally to see how his wife and child are doing. He does not live there. When he arrived, he inquired about his wife’s whereabouts while he was gone, and Mariam informed him that his wife frequently doesn’t sleep at home and is picked up and dropped off by different vehicles.

“This was what made her very angry so she beat Mariam for talking and them burnt her two breast with hot iron”.

On investigation, it  was gathered that the case was  reported at the Ilaje police station, in Bariga. 

However, even though the case was filed, it was learnt that money was exchanged, and the alleged abuser was let off the hook.

The alleged abuser who showed complete disregard for the consequences of her actions has been openly bragging about escaping accountability adding that  she would always buy her way out.

“ So she has being bragging that nothing will happen to her, that she’s going to pay her way out of it because she was taken to the station and they collected money from her and allowed her go free

“ I heard she paid the sun of 200k to have it died down and she came back to brag that if they still go and report her she is going to still pay herself out

“ The case was first reported on Saturday 23/09/ 2023 at Ilaje,that’s the nearest station to us in bariga and later transferred to Ikeja Police Station, where Zainab’s mother got legal assistance. A lawyer was engaged, and Zainab was once again released on the same day she was detained.

“ She was at ikeja on Monday and release on that same Monday 25/09/2023. They claimed to release her because she had a child with her.

Meanwhile, VARSH Foundation a non governmental organization committed to creating a society free of all forms of sexual abuse, child abuse, and gender discrimination has appealed to relevant authorities to revisit the case, ensure a thorough investigation, and prosecute the perpetrator according to the full extent of the law. 

When contacted, the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O) for Lagos command, Benjamin Hundeyin asked our reporter to text him as he is on an official duty.

The PPRO however didn’t reply the text messages sent to him as at the time of filing this report.
